Output cfb39dcadad213f025fd92d9d9b680b45f4b4d651125507d7cbbf5850167349e:0

value
20642664
script pubkey
OP_0 OP_PUSHBYTES_20 e2693ad45cfa3e01167a7134fd4ad82de3cb01e2
address
bc1quf5n44zulglqz9n6wy606jkc9h3ukq0zasnvpg
transaction
cfb39dcadad213f025fd92d9d9b680b45f4b4d651125507d7cbbf5850167349e
confirmations
209315
spent
true